Kathleen Clyde Committee
$3,586,368Total Contributions
$3,687,104Total Expenditures
Financial Activity
Top Contributors
Total Contributions | Name |
---|---|
$138,500.00 | Ohio Democratic Party State Candidate Fund |
$44,114.00 | Oapse Afscme Turnaround Ohio PAC |
$40,407.00 | Richard H Rosenthal |
$36,068.68 | SEIU Ohio State Joint Council PCE |
$29,700.00 | Ohio Federation of Teachers Political Contributing Entity |
$28,915.58 | The Matriots |
$27,915.58 | International Brotherhood of Electrical Workers IBEW PAC - Federal |
$27,900.00 | United Steelworkers of America District 1 PCE |
$27,500.00 | Ocsea/afscme Local 11 Political Action Fund |
$26,707.00 | Afscme Ohio Council 8 AFL-CIO PAC |
Top Payees
Total Expenditures | Payee |
---|---|
$1,993,853.00 | Screen Strategies Media |
$711,535.06 | Ohio Democratic Party |
$158,635.00 | Left Hook Communications |
$117,455.79 | The Strategy Group Company LLC |
$111,499.90 | Global Strategy Group LLC |
$102,224.00 | Dixon Davis Media Group LLC |
$57,495.64 | Run the World Digital |
$37,514.51 | Vantiv Ecommerce |
$34,758.56 | Bellwether Strategies |
$32,493.00 | Rapid Return |
